@rjfwhite/random-lib
Version:
Core engine for MML
13 lines • 473 B
TypeScript
import { AttachmentRule, Behavior } from "./types";
import { WorldMaker } from "../WorldMaker";
export declare class DestroyOnDeath extends Behavior {
private deathDetectedTime;
private readonly deathDelay;
constructor(element: Element, world: WorldMaker);
static getAttachmentRules(): AttachmentRule[];
onAttach(): void;
onDetach(): void;
private destroyElement;
tick(deltaTime: number): void;
}
//# sourceMappingURL=DestroyOnDeath.d.ts.map